Obviously you didn't watch the whole video or missed a lot.

-8-core processor
-GDDR 5 memory 175GB/s bandwidth
-Dual Shock 4 controller w/ touch pad, share, lightbar and more.
-Games remain in session by pressing power off button on control...Put the PS4 into sleep mode...No more long boot times...Just wake it up and go...Low power consumption.
-Secondary chip to manage background processing
-Be able to stream legacy games; although I'd prefer the actual disc, but it's better than nothing.
-Personalize; system can get to know you. Likes and dislikes. Predict games you like to download ahead of time.

There are plenty of features mentioned that does not focus on Facebook, yet you use it as your main argument. Why?

It will be able to play a downloaded game as it is being downloaded and update the system/games when powered off. This means no more waiting for updates to install and games to be downloaded. The streaming of gameplay will make it possible for friends to spectate or even join if you so choose. And then we have the hardware specifications that, while in this stage only numbers, will enable very heavy gameplay as the developers get to know the platform. And this is just a first look. Sony's intro showcased their Global game partners; Ubisoft is Canadian, Media Molecule is British, Blizzard is American, SuckerPunch is American, Quantic Dream is French, SquarEnix is Japanese, Guerrilla Games is Dutch, etc.
